S1-S6 segmentsSix transmembrane α-helices
S4 voltage sensorPositively charged residues detect membrane potential
P-loop (H5)Forms the ion selectivity filter
S6 C-terminusForms the inner pore gate
N-terminal T1 domainTetramERization domain, mediates auxiliary subunit interaction
KChIP binding siteIntracellular N-terminal binding for KChIP proteins
DPP6/DPP10 bindingC-terminal interaction for trafficking modulation
CaMKII phosphorylationEnhances current, reduces inactivation
